Residential Drain Cleaning in Columbus, OH
Residential drain cleaning services involve the removal of blockages, buildup, and debris from household plumbing systems to ensure proper drainage throughout the home. These services typically address issues in kitchen sinks, bathroom drains, laundry lines, and main sewer lines. Projects often include clearing clogs caused by hair, grease, soap scum, or foreign objects, as well as routine cleaning to prevent future problems. Homeowners usually seek drain cleaning when experiencing slow drains, foul odors, or backups, aiming to restore smooth water flow and avoid costly repairs.
Before requesting drain cleaning, property owners should understand the location of the affected drains and whether multiple fixtures are involved. It’s helpful to know if the issue is isolated or widespread, as this can influence the scope of the service needed. Additionally, homeowners should be aware of any previous plumbing issues or repairs, as these can impact the approach taken to clear the drains effectively. Proper diagnosis ensures that the appropriate cleaning methods are used to maintain the plumbing system’s functionality and longevity.

Common Residential Drain Cleaning Jobs
Kitchen drain cleaning - clears clogs in sink and garbage disposal lines to restore proper drainage.
Bathroom drain cleaning - resolves slow or backing-up drains in showers, tubs, and sinks.
Main sewer line cleaning - removes blockages that affect the entire plumbing system.
Floor drain cleaning - maintains proper flow in basement and utility area drains.
Outdoor drain cleaning - clears yard and storm drains to prevent flooding and backups.
Drain line inspection services - identifies hidden obstructions or damage within drain pipes.
Residential Drain Cleaning Questions
What are common signs of a clogged drain? Slow draining water, gurgling sounds, and foul odors often indicate a clog in the drain system.
Is drain cleaning safe for all types of pipes? Yes, professional drain cleaning methods are safe for most residential pipe materials, including plastic and metal.
How often should drains be cleaned? Regular maintenance every 1-2 years helps prevent buildup and keeps drains flowing smoothly.
What causes drain clogs in homes? Common causes include hair, grease, soap scum, and debris buildup, especially in kitchen and bathroom drains.
